شرح TCP/IP Layers (الجزء الثانى)
2-internet layer
- هذه الطبقة هى نفسها طبقة الشبكة فى Osi Layer , فهى تقوم بإضافة ال ip (للمصدر والهدف) للداتا المرسلة لها من ال Transport وتتم عملية توجيه الباكت حسب نوع البروتوكول (rip – ospf – igrp ) المستخدم (وعندما تدرس ccna سوف تعرف ان شاء الله تعالى عمل هذه البروتوكولات ودور كل منها فى عملية التوجيه).
- البروتوكولات : IP – NAT
- IP
- يوجد نوعان من الايبى IPV4 و IPV6 ولكن الاخير وإن كان تم العمل به من عدة ايام ولكن ليس على نطاق واسع
,اما IPV4 مكون من 32 بت , 4octets , وكل octet مكونة من 8بت.
- ينقسم ال Ip الى خمسة classes كما مبين بالشكل التالى فى class A يبدأ من صفر الى 126 و فى class B يبدأ من 128 الى 191 وهكذا الى باقى التصنيفات:-
- كما يتضح من الشكل السابق يتكون IP V4 من خمس تصنيفات ولكن المستخدم فعليا هو أول ثلاثة A , B , C, اما Class D فيستخدم لل Multicast و الاخير Class E فهو محجوز للاستخدامات المستقبلية وعلى حد علمى فهو ل IPV6 , وهناك ملحوظة فى الصورة السابقة ان فى Class A ال 127 غير مذكورة وهذا لانها تستخدم ك LOOP BACK بمعنى PING على كرت الشبكة ,وايضا فى Class E غير مذكور 255 لانها تستخدم ك Broadcast.
- فى داخل الشبكات يوجد نوعين من الايبهات ايبهات خاصة (private ip) داخل الشركة وايبهات تسمى ( real ip) للدخول على النت , والايبهات الخاصة هى جزء حددته ال IANA وهذا لكى يتواصل الافراد معا داخل الشبكات الخاصة اما اذا أردت الدخول على الانترنت فلابد ان تحصل على real ip .
- ال private Ip توضح الصورة التالية من اين يبدأ واين ينتهى بداخل كل تصنيف.
- توضح الصورة السابقة الايبهات الخاصة التى نستخدمها دائما داخل الشركات وفى الكوفى نت .
- فى Class A يستخدم بشكل اكتر فى الشركات الكبيرة حيث انه يتسع لعدد اجهزة اكثر وشبكات اقل فيتسع لعدد مايزيد عن 16 مليون جهاز .
- اماClass B فيستخد فى الشبكات الاقل حجما ويتسع لعدد اجهزة مايقرب من 65 الف جهاز.
- اما الاخير Class C فهو يتسع 254 جهاز ويتسخدم بصورة اكثر فى الشركات الصغيرة .
- واخيرا انصحك ايضا بالرجوع لموضوع تقسيم الشبكة الواحدة لعدة شبكات فمنه تستطيع ان تجعل كل قسم داخل الشركة شبكة مستقلة .
- اخيرا ولكى يتم الانتهاء من هذا الموضوع مع كل كلاس من السالف ذكرهم يوجد شىء اسمه Subnet Mask وهو به تستطيع ان تحدد به نوع كل شبكة , ولكى يتم فهم النقطة بشكل واضح سوف اشرح تعريفين هامين:-
Network ID:
وهو الجزء الثابت وهويحدد لك نوع الشبكة , ففى التصنيف الاول يكون هو اول byte (اول بايت هو اول octet) اما فى التصنيف الثانى فيمثل الاول والثانى اما فى التصنيف الثالث فاول ثلاث byte كما بالجدول السابق فعلى سبيل المثال الشبكة كلاس A تكون Subnet Mask الخاص بها (255.0.0.0) اما فى كلاس B فيكون Subnet Mask الخاص بها (255.255.0.0) اما الاخير كلاس CSubnet Mask الخاص بها هو (255.255.255.0) , ولو قمت بالدخول على كارت الشبكة الخاص بك لوضع ايبى بشكل يدوى فسوف تجد ان ال Subnet Mask يوضع بشكل اوتومايتك كما يتضح بالفيديو التالى
Host ID:
وهو خاص بالجزء المتغير الذى تضعه بنفسك وهو متغير لانه يتغير من جهاز لاخر اما Network ID فهو ثابت مع كل الاجهزة بالشبكة.
- طريقة اعداد ال ip على الكمبيوتر
يوجد ثلاث طرق يمكن بها اعداد الايبى على جهاز الكمبيوتر:-
1- يدويا : ادخل على start --> network connection --- > local area connection ----- > properties ----- > ipv4 ------ > general --------- > use the following ip
ثم تقوم بوضع الاعدادات يدويا.
2- اوتوماتيك باستخدام خدمة Dhcp: حيث تقوم هذه الخدمة بتوزيع مجموعة من الاعدادات بصورة اوتوماتيك على كل الاجهزة الموجودة بالشبكة منها (ip – subnet mask – default getaway – dns - wins).
Dhcp ---- > ipv4 ------ > new scope ------ > next ------ > ip address range ------ > next ------ > next again ----- > On Lease Duration ------ > next ------- >
No, I will configure these options later ------ > Finish
or
Yes , I want to configure option now ------- > next ---- > default gateway ---- > next --- > Dns --- > next --- > wins --- > yes I want to active this scope now ---- > next --- > Finish
هذه فقط صورة مبسطة جدا للخطوات وبعدها تجد انه يتم توزيع الايبهات على الشبكة بشكل اوتوماتيك.
3- يدويا باستخدام cmd : وذلك بالدخول من خلال start ------- > run ------- > cmd ثم تنفيذ الأمر التالى
معلومة هامة:
عندما اطلب موقع للدخول على الانترنت فالطبيعى ان يمر الباكيت بعدة روترات فهنا ال ip لايتغير من المصدر للهدف end to end , انما الذى يتغير هو الماك ادرس next hope فيحل الماك لكل روتر مكان الاخر ليتحدث مع الروتر التالى .
Network interface-1
- · هذا الطبقة تحتوى على الطبقتين (Data link - physical) السابق شرحهم فى ال osi layer وبالتالى فهى تقوم بالأتى :-
- وضع الماك ادرس
- اكتشاف الاخطاء error detection
- تحديد افضل وقت لارسال البيانات وذلك بالتأكد من خلو الكابل من أى بيانات قبل الارسال ((CSMA/CD.
- بتحول الداتا إلى اشارات كهربائية لتمريرها فى السلك.
- · ويوجد العديد من البروتوكولات التى تعمل فى هذه الطبقة ولكن أهمها هى Mac ,Arp,.
مصادر تم الاستعانة بها:-
شرخ كل من محمد سمير وياسر رمزى ومحمود سرحان
MCTS Self-Paced Training Kit ..Exam 70-642
تعليقات 4
إرسال تعليق
Cancel